Abstract:
These case studies were developed by the Health and Safety Laboratory (HSL). They show real examples of how employers have tackled the problem of violence to lone workers. They illustrate a range of cost effective and practical solutions for tackling work-related violence that may also be relevant to your organisation. There are 19 case studies, ranging from the self-employed (eg a window cleaner) to large multi-national companies (eg insurance and financial firms). Each case study describes: the organisation and the job of the lone worker; the key risks of violence; real examples of incidents of work-related violence; measures taken to reduce the risks of violence; factors which sometimes reduce the effectiveness of measures; and benefits and costs of measures.
